rquit.github.io:网站
【rquit.github.io:网站】是一个在线平台,很可能是一个个人或团队用来展示其项目、分享技术知识或提供某种服务的网站。在这个特定的场景中,我们主要关注的是与"HTML"相关的知识点。HTML(HyperText Markup Language)是构建网页的基础语言,用于定义网页的结构和内容。下面将深入探讨HTML在构建网站时的关键要素和相关概念。 1. **HTML基本结构**:HTML文档通常以`<!DOCTYPE html>`开头,表明这是一个HTML5文档。接着是`<html>`元素,它是整个文档的根元素。在`<html>`内,有两个重要的子元素——`<head>`和`<body>`。`<head>`包含元数据,如标题、字符编码等,而`<body>`则包含用户在浏览器中看到的实际内容。 2. **标题元素**:`<title>`位于`<head>`中,它定义了浏览器标签页上的标题,同时也影响搜索引擎优化(SEO)。 3. **文本内容**:HTML通过各种元素来表示文本内容,例如`<p>`用于段落,`<h1>`至`<h6>`定义不同级别的标题,`<em>`表示强调,`<strong>`表示重要性,`<a>`则用于创建超链接。 4. **列表**:HTML提供了有序列表`<ol>`和无序列表`<ul>`,以及列表项`<li>`来组织信息。 5. **图像**:`<img>`元素用于插入图像,其`src`属性指向图像的URL,`alt`属性提供替代文本,对于无法显示图像的场合非常有用。 6. **链接**:`<a>`元素不仅可以链接到其他网页,还可以锚定页面内部的某个位置,实现页面内的跳转。 7. **表格**:`<table>`、`<tr>`(行)、`<td>`(单元格)和`<th>`(表头单元格)用于创建数据表格。 8. **区块元素与内联元素**:`<div>`是区块级元素,常用于组合内容或添加样式,而`<span>`是内联元素,通常用于部分文本的样式调整。 9. **CSS集成**:虽然标签主要关注HTML,但通常会用到CSS(Cascading Style Sheets)来控制页面的布局和样式。可以使用`<style>`元素在`<head>`内定义内联样式,或者通过`<link>`引用外部CSS文件。 10. **响应式设计**:现代网站往往需要适应不同设备的屏幕大小,HTML5引入了媒体查询`@media`和弹性盒模型`display: flex`或网格布局`display: grid`来实现响应式设计。 11. **语义化标签**:HTML5引入了更多语义化的元素,如`<header>`、`<nav>`、`<article>`、`<aside>`和`<footer>`,这些元素有助于搜索引擎理解页面内容并提高可访问性。 12. **表单元素**:`<form>`、`<input>`、`<textarea>`、`<select>`和`<button>`用于创建交互式表单,收集用户输入。 13. **JavaScript集成**:HTML通常与JavaScript结合使用,通过`<script>`元素引入脚本,实现动态交互和功能扩展。 14. **Web组件**:HTML5的Web组件特性允许开发者创建自定义的可重用元素,提高了代码的模块化和复用性。 HTML是构建网页的核心语言,通过一系列标签和属性来组织和呈现内容。了解并熟练掌握这些知识点,能帮助开发者创建功能齐全、布局美观且易于维护的网站。在rquit.github.io的项目中,我们可以期待看到这些HTML原理和技巧的实际应用。
- 1
- 粉丝: 28
- 资源: 4596
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- C#/WinForm演示退火算法(源码)
- 如何在 IntelliJ IDEA 中去掉 Java 方法注释后的空行.md
- 小程序官方组件库,内含各种组件实例,以及调用方式,多种UI可修改
- 2011年URL缩短服务JSON数据集
- Kaggle-Pokemon with stats(宠物小精灵数据)
- Harbor 最新v2.12.0的ARM64版离线安装包
- 【VUE网站静态模板】Uniapp 框架开发响应式网站,企业项目官网-APP,web网站,小程序快速生成 多语言:支持中文简体,中文繁体,英语
- 使用哈夫曼编码来对字符串进行编码HuffmanEncodingExample
- Ti芯片C2000内核手册
- c语言实现的花式爱心源码